From 7d1a770cff655e3d9d6ba71a9c5319a0eaa4fc4d Mon Sep 17 00:00:00 2001 From: kappa1 Date: Sat, 10 Apr 2010 18:07:50 +0000 Subject: [PATCH] fix infinite focus loop when using Display.setParent() + JWS + Linux. --- src/java/org/lwjgl/opengl/LinuxDisplay.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/java/org/lwjgl/opengl/LinuxDisplay.java b/src/java/org/lwjgl/opengl/LinuxDisplay.java index dcf8d5c9..61332e88 100644 --- a/src/java/org/lwjgl/opengl/LinuxDisplay.java +++ b/src/java/org/lwjgl/opengl/LinuxDisplay.java @@ -846,7 +846,7 @@ final class LinuxDisplay implements DisplayImplementation { if (parent_focus) { setInputFocusUnsafe(current_window); } - else { + else if (xembedded) { setInputFocusUnsafe(0); } }